persuasions

英 [pəˈsweɪʒənz]

美 [pərˈsweɪʒənz]

n.  说服; 劝说; (宗教或政治)信仰
persuasion的复数

柯林斯词典

  • N-UNCOUNT 说服;劝说
    Persuasionis the act of persuading someone to do something or to believe that something is true.
    1. Only after much persuasion from Ellis had she agreed to hold a show at all...
      埃利斯劝了她半天后她才同意办一场展览。
    2. She was using all her powers of persuasion to induce the Griffins to remain in Rollway.
      她在极力劝说格里芬斯一家留在罗尔威。
  • N-COUNT 信仰;信念
    If you areofa particularpersuasion, you have a particular belief or set of beliefs.
    1. It is a national movement and has within it people of all political persuasions...
      这是一场全国性运动,参加者的政治信仰各不相同。
    2. Fortunately for me, my kids are of the persuasion that their failings are of their own making.
      对我来说幸运的是,我的孩子们相信失败是他们自己造成的。
